What does VMware pay a Product Manager on an H-1B?
$140k VMware has filed 81 H-1B labor condition applications for the role of Product Manager with the U.S. Department of Labor between FY2017 and FY2023 at a median base salary of $140k. Most of those filings fall between $131k and $156k. Base salary is the wage stated on the filing, not total compensation.

Filings and pay by year
Product Manager at VMware, by fiscal year
Show the numbers behind this chart
| Fiscal year | Filings | Median base salary |
|---|---|---|
| FY2023 | 11 | $159k |
| FY2022 | 2 | $179k |
| FY2021 | 12 | $141k |
| FY2020 | 10 | $148k |
| FY2019 | 18 | $144k |
| FY2018 | 7 | $141k |
| FY2017 | 21 | $132k |
Where this work is
Work locations named on the filings, most common first
| Location | Filings | Median base salary |
|---|---|---|
| Palo Alto, CA | 44 | $143k |
| Atlanta, GA | 12 | $110k |
| San Francisco, CA | 11 | $140k |
| Allen Park, MI | 2 | $102k |
| San Jose, CA | 2 | $179k |
| Seattle, WA | 2 | $143k |
| Ann Arbor, MI | 1 | $110k |
| Bellevue, WA | 1 | $170k |
| Broomfield, CO | 1 | $100k |
| Charlottesville, VA | 1 | $160k |
| Oakland, CA | 1 | $160k |
| Santa Monica, CA | 1 | $142k |
Prevailing-wage level
The experience level DOL assigns the role, I (entry) to IV (expert)
| Level | Filings | Median base salary |
|---|---|---|
| Level I | 6 | $140k |
| Level II | 30 | $140k |
| Level III | 14 | $160k |
| Level IV | 6 | $174k |
